Today we bring you part 2 in Vanessa's two part Math Therapy Masterclass on how to start the coming school year with renewed confidence - for yourself and for your students!

In part 1 she shared 4 exercises/experiences you can try this summer (check it out here ICYMI), and she's back with 4 more:

5) practice being bad at something
6) find a mindset/psychology book/podcast (suggestions below)
7) try Duolingo Math
8) face your math trauma as a grown up

5) practice being bad at something

Vanessa Vakharia

are going to start with tip number one for today, but tip number five overall, which is, this is my favorite one, to be honest, so we are starting off strong. Practice being bad at something. You heard me. If you are listening to this, actually, if you are listening and you are like, "Yeah, I'm listening because I'm hoping to get some advice for my friends because I don't really understand this whole math anxiety thing. I've never felt a- anxious around math," and especially if you're a teacher listening to this, this experiment is for you. I want you to get in the shoes of your students and your colleagues and the people around you in day-to-day life who are afraid of math, and I want you to practice being bad at something. There's a whole saying in yoga, you know, in the practice, and when we talk about yoga and meditation, one of the biggest concepts that we need to lock down from day one is the idea of beginner's mind. Beginner's mind. What does it mean to be starting something new, to be learning something for the first time, to not be an expert at that thing? When we get in the seat of beginner's mind, it actually is quite a relief. Gone are the expectations that we have to know everything, but with that relief also comes that reflex anxiety of, "I have no fucking idea what I'm doing." But the beautiful thing about beginner's mind is we are to welcome that feeling, to say, "I don't expect myself to know anything about this, to be, quote, unquote, good at it. I just expect myself to sit down and do it like a beginner would, and to see what comes up." Now, beginner's mind for you, the listener, means that you need to practice being bad at something. That means go do something that you don't feel good at, that maybe you've never tried before, certainly not that you have mastered, because it allows you to understand how your students are feeling about math. Maybe you don't feel that way about math, but maybe you feel that way about playing guitar, or playing an instrument, or singing, or playing a sport, or learning how to tap dance, or chess, or learning a language, or juggling, or pickleball. Whatever I'm saying right now that is triggering you to be like, "Oh God, I would suck at that," or, "I've never been good at that," ding, ding, ding. Why am I saying ding, ding, ding so much? I did it last episode, too. Anyways, that's your thing. There, I found it for you. That's your thing Whatever the thing is that you're alwa- you know how everyone's like, "I'm not a math person," and you're like, "Everyone's a math person"? I know low-key you're saying, "I'm not a blank person." I don't know what it is, but I know you're saying it. "I'm not an artist. I'm not a creative person. I'm not good with maps." I don't, I don't know. I don't know what you're saying. But whatever that thing is, that is the thing you are going to start practicing. How are you gonna practice it? Well, I'm not sure. You're gonna just do something, five minutes of that thing. If it's a guitar, you are going to pick up a guitar and start strumming, or you're gonna go onto YouTube and click Guitar Lessons for Absolute Beginners, and you are just gonna start practicing. If it's chess, you're gonna watch a tutorial and play. You're gonna call your friend that plays chess, and you're gonna say, "Can you come over and play a game with me?" If it's a language, well, there are apps for that. If it is knitting, go buy some knitting needles and some, I don't know, yarn. Is that what they knit with? And again, y- well, there's YouTube now. There's so much stuff. Like, just look up a lesson on something and do it, or find a friend who is good at the thing that you suck at and be like, "Can you teach me one thing about this today?" That's it. And you are going to practice. You're gonna practice every day, every week, five minutes. That's all I want is five minutes. Because imagine, this is what you'd say to your students. You'd say, "Just do five minutes of math a day." So I want you to do five minutes of the thing that scares you, that you don't feel good at, a day. I don't just want you to do this so you'll get better at it. Okay? So first of all, here's what's gonna happen. You're gonna get better at it. You are. You're gonna notice that you're getting better. You're not gonna be where you wanna be. You're still gonna think you suck, but you're going to be getting better at it. And you getting better at it is going to show your brain, your body, your mind, your soul, "I can get better at things that I don't feel good at." Now, guess what? For many of you, practicing being bad at something, you're gonna think to yourself, "Well, I might as well practice being bad at math because I feel like I'm bad at math." I'm not saying you can't do that. You can. But I would love for you to actually practice being bad at something other than math to start with. I really would, because it is the same muscle you're exercising, and my guess is math is too laden with, like, meaning and overwhelm, and the stakes are high, and you've gotta go teach it. And, uh, like, it feel... it might be too triggering to start with math. I would like you to start with something you feel bad at that has, like, zero stakes. Like, you don't ever have to do it. You don't have to do it as a job. Maybe it's cooking. Maybe you're like, "I'm so bad at cooking," and you could just start learning how to make some basic meals. Or like, I don't know, how to, like, chop carrots. Like, I don't understand how people do it so thinly, you know what I mean? Like, maybe it's that. Start with something low stakes. Do it for a couple of weeks. Again, you are showing your nervous system, "I can do new things. I can do hard things. I can change." Right? Once that starts getting into your bones, you can transfer that to math. You know, Mel Robbins has been all over my feed lately saying every time you start your day doing something hard, for example, exercising, it makes the rest of the day easier because you've already done this hard thing, so in comparison, everything's like, oh, that's kind of chill. I... A lot of my friends feel this way about cold plunging. They're like, "If you just cold plunge first thing in the morning, I've done the hardest thing I'm gonna do that day. Everything feels easier." That's how I feel about math. Honestly, that's why I'm doing this entire program. Yes, it's about math, but it's about math as a gateway. Once you show yourself you can progress with math, you can get over this fear, you can just feel more confident around math, all of a sudden, that thing sets the tone. You're like, "Oh, if I could do that with math, what else can I do it with?" And that's why this is so important, is to practice being bad at something. Whatever that thing is for you that you just think you can't get better at, I want you to practice being bad at it, realize it's okay to be bad at it, to not be where you are, and also to see yourself changing and growing, and to remember, if you're doing it in that area, you can also do it in math. I also wanna-- want you to notice how quickly do you get frustrated? How uncomfortable is the confusion? When do you wanna quit? What stops you from quitting? Because that is exactly where your students live in your class every single day. Confusion isn't failure. Confusion is what learning feels like, but it doesn't feel good, and I want you to feel that. I want you to feel that so that you feel it every day, and by day five, you're like, "Oh, this is just normal. It's not that scary anymore. I recognize this is just a part of the learning process."

8) face your math trauma as a grown up

Vanessa Vakharia

And finally, the last experiment of the eight, this is a big one, okay? Remember, I am here to show you how to feel more confident about math in the fall, and one of the things, one of our biggest triggers for all of us, one of the reasons we're here right now listening to this podcast is because something broke our heart. There was a math concept or lesson that broke us, and we have never healed. And so experiment number eight is to go back and relearn the thing that broke your heart. And if you're anything like me right now, you're like, "No, no, no," your entire body is fighting this. Like, that's as though I was saying, "Okay, Vanessa, the thing you have to do is go and finally learn how taxes work." I would also-- I would throw my microphone out the window and be like, "I hate you now." I get it. I get it. But before you press stop and, like, decide to disown me and never listen to this podcast again, let me tell you something right now. The thing that broke your heart in math class was probably something you learned, like, under the age of 14. I j- I just want you to think about it this way. I'm not trying to excuse myself, but I'm like, taxes are like a grown-up thing, okay? So they're scarier because it's more recent that this thing started stressing me out. For you guys, the thing that broke your heart in math class was probably something you learned under the age of 14. It was probably fractions, or maybe it was algebra. Maybe it was when letters got introduced into math class, as a lot of people say, right? Like, maybe it was your times tables. Maybe it happened that young. Maybe it was long division. Like, I'm just stating some common ones, but maybe it was something else. My point is, as an adult, you have now dealt with a million things that are way harder and way more higher stakes than not being able to add two fractions together. At the time, it seemed impossible. At the time, think about your young brain, like your nine-year-old brain. The knowledge it had to draw on was very limited compared to all of the knowledge you have to draw on now. You are going to be able to learn that thing. I know you don't believe me, but it is not gonna be as scary as you remember it. Your body is remembering and hanging on to the trauma response of the math trauma that occurred when you tried to learn this thing and you couldn't learn it, something bad happened, or you simply were just like, "I can't learn this thing, and I feel really, really dumb." Your body's gonna remember that forever unless you teach it a different story, and you can only teach it a different story by giving it a different experience. So you need to go back and relearn that thing. Now, listen I'm not asking you to relearn this thing because you're gonna teach it. Maybe you're listening and you're like, "I don't- I'm- I teach grade two. I don't need to go back and learn algebra. I don't e-" You don't need to. You don't need to learn it 'cause you're gonna teach it. But learning it is going to prove something so major to you that I really want you to do it. I want you to do it for you, not for the kids you're gonna teach. I want you to do it for you. So first you need to get really clear. What was that thing? I might have already said it and you were like, "Oh God, just don't. Fractions. No." Like, I don't know what it was. What was that thing? Let's get clear. What was it? Once you're clear on it, let's figure out how you're gonna learn it. I want you to picture you had to teach it to somebody. What would you do? Like imagine you had to teach it to your younger self. What would you have done for that person? Would you have pulled on some resources that maybe didn't even exist during that time? Like, we've got so much at our fingertips right now, right? Like, would you pull on some resources? Would you get your best friend to do it? Would you get, like, your favorite math teacher that you know now to teach it to you? Would you ask ChatGPT? Would you need something more tactile and visual? Would you want manipulatives? Would you... Like, I don't, I don't know. Whatever it is you need, we can get it for you, right? Like we're-- It's 2026. We can get whatever that thing is you need, right? Like, I know so many incredible math teachers, some of you are probably listening to this podcast, that I'm like, if I ever had to explain a concept to the younger me or to a student right now, I'd be like, "Oh, get... Honestly, get Deborah Peart. There. Just get..." I, I know for a fact she's gonna teach it in the best way. Like, do you know what I mean? Like, I'm like, if Deborah taught me anything, like, I would learn it. It would, it would be the-- That would, that would be the end of that. Do you know what I mean? Or like Allison Mello. I'm like, "Yeah, you teach me something." You know what I mean? Like, there are people, and, and you, especially if you work in a school, if you're a teacher, you probably know the person that you're like, "Oh, that math teacher. I wish that..." That person that you're like, "I wish that person was my math teacher," get them to reteach you the concept that broke your heart. That's what we're doing. That's it. That's it. And this isn't because you have to teach it, right? It's because the younger version of you deserve that rom-com ending, and you're gonna get it right now. The truth is, every time your adult brain understands something that your younger self couldn't, you are rewriting the story, and that is math therapy. That's what it's all about.
